Last month, Governor Greg Gianforte announced eight appointments to the Western Montana Conservation Commission.
Their work began during the inaugural meeting of the WMCC on Nov. 2-3.
“Each of you brings your own background expertise and together you’re better because of that combined knowledge and experience,” said Lieutenant Governor Kristen Juras “Thank you for taking this commitment on and for working to preserve our Montana waters.”
Yaak local Sandy Beder-Miller is the private industry representative for the commission.
